Castability is the ease of forming a quality casting. A very castable part design is easily developed, incurs minimal tooling costs, requires minimal energy, and has few rejections. Castability can refer to a part design or a material property.
==Part design== Part design and geometry directly affect the castability, with volume, surface area and the number of features being the most important attributes.
